About this facility
James T Champion is a state government-owned nursing home in Meridian, Mississippi (Lauderdale County), certified for Medicaid participation since April 2010. The facility has 70 certified beds and an average daily census of 59.9 residents.
According to CMS Care Compare, James T Champion holds an overall star rating of 4 out of 5, above the Mississippi state average of 2.76. The rating is built from four component scores: a health inspection rating of 4, a quality measure (QM) rating of 1, and a staffing rating of 5.
Nurse staffing data reported to CMS shows total nurse staffing of 6.83 hours per resident per day, including 1.40 RN hours per resident per day. Nursing staff turnover is reported at 33.8%.
On the penalty record, CMS lists no federal fines on record for this facility (0 fines totaling $0.00) and no payment denials. No abuse icon is displayed for this facility in the CMS data provided, and no Special Focus Facility designation is indicated. There is no chain affiliation listed in the data, and CMS data indicates no change of ownership in the past 12 months.
Families evaluating James T Champion should note the notable gap between its strong health inspection and staffing scores and its low quality measure rating of 1, which reflects clinical outcome measures tracked separately by CMS.
